Abstract

The automatic faucet assembly production line mainly comprises an edge body conveying device, a sealing ring automatic assembly device, a chassis conveying device, a middle body conveying device, an edge/middle body assembly device, a chassis assembly device and a finished product conveying device; the automatic sealing ring assembling devices are respectively arranged at the outer two sides of the edge body conveying device, the finished product conveying device is arranged at the tail end of the chassis assembling device, the chassis conveying device is connected with the chassis assembling device, and the edge/middle body assembling device is arranged between the edge body conveying device and the chassis assembling device and is connected with the chassis assembling device; the assembly production line provided by the invention has the advantages that the problem that the water faucet is completely assembled manually is solved, the purpose of batch automatic production is realized, the missing locking of screws and the missing installation of sealing rings caused by human factors are prevented in the assembly process, the reject ratio of products is greatly reduced, and the production efficiency is improved.

Background technology
For a kind of faucet, it is made up of the chassis of the intermediate body member between two limit bodies and two limit bodies of connection and two limit bodies fastening insertions;At present, the assembling of this faucet existing is entirely and manually assembles, and its production efficiency is low, and the production to this faucet mass is extremely limited;Owing to using man-made assembly, also tend to cause the generation of the leakage lock phenomenon such as screw, neglected loading sealing ring the most in an assembling process, make bad product be controlled the most in time.
Therefore, it is badly in need of the automatic assembly line of a kind of modernization, meets the needs that mass faucet produces.

The operation principle of the present invention is: on the limit body smelting tool that some limits body is respectively inserted in limit bulk transport device 1, this limit body smelting has under the drive of chain 1a1, limit body is through sealing ring automatic assembling device 2, had 1b ' 1 by the inner sleeve sealing ring smelting in this device and overcoat sealing ring smelting tool 1b ' 2 opposite side body respectively is inserted in inside and outside sealing ring, and detected whether Lou to overlap sealing ring by infrared inductor, differentiate defective products in time, prevent from flowing into next process;
It is inserted in the limit body of sealing ring, the limit bulk mechanical hands 3a2 in limit/intermediate body member assembling device 3 grabs two ends in the assembling slide block 3a3 in the guide chute 3b1 in limit/intermediate body member assembling device 3 respectively;
The most some intermediate body member carry respectively through intermediate body member conveyer device 5, and grabbed the centre of assembling slide block 3a3 in the guide chute 3b1 in limit/intermediate body member assembling device 3 by the intermediate body member mechanical hand 3a1 in limit/intermediate body member assembling device 3 respectively, and it is and captures the corresponding placement of limit body assembling slide block 3a3 two ends;Owing to the guide chute 3b1 in limit/intermediate body member assembling device 3 is a gradually constriction structure setting, i.e. assemble the limit body at slide block 3a3 two ends and assemble the intermediate body member in the middle of slide block 3a3 in guide chute 3b1, and by under the dragging of chain, the limit body making two ends is gradually drawn close to intermediate body member, thus reaches mutually to be seated the purpose of assembling;
After above-mentioned limit body and intermediate body member assemble, under the drive of chain, it is delivered in chassis assembling device 4;
On the fixed disk blowing plate 6b1 that some chassis are respectively inserted in chassis conveyer device 6, under the drive of chain, chassis is delivered to pusher mould 6a8 position, chassis;
Limit body after described assembling and intermediate body member and carried the chassis come by chassis conveyer device 6, last assembling is carried out respectively in chassis assembling device 4, in chassis assembling device 4, screw locking machine structure (not shown) lock screw and point gum machine carry out a glue and fix simultaneously, thus complete the assembling of faucet.
